When a couple books me for an elopement wedding, they’re not just asking me to take pictures of their ceremony. These couples are asking for far more than that.
Now, don’t get me wrong, couples who choose to do traditional weddings are extremely brave as they stand face-to-face with anxiety, parent opinions, year trends and a billion decisions they need to make every day leading up to their wedding day. These couples love each other so much that they are willing to live through the chaos as long as it means they’re married to each other at the end of the day.
What I’ve come to notice is that every couple’s love is unique. To want to celebrate your wedding day with family and closest friends makes perfect sense. But consider those couples who don’t feel like using traditions are required or necessary to celebrate their
It’s about your relationship and each other, not about the stress of the day.
NO RULES. Eloping isn’t like how it used to be, it can be, or you can have a small intimate ceremony with your people and then have an epic adventure later on. Or no ceremony at all, just an epic location and someone that marries you. See, no rules.
Go as little or as big as you want
Make it an adventure, go somewhere you’ve been dying to experience together and bring me along to capture your authentic selves to have memories for a lifetime
Eloping isn’t about running away from the traditional-wedding-drama. Eloping is about intention, authenticity, adventure and value.
